OATMEAL COOKED IN MILK WITH VARIATIONS

1 tsp salt
2 cups milk
2 cups water
2 cups Quaker Oats, uncooked (quick or old-fashioned)

Add salt to milk and water in saucepan; bring to a boil.

FOR FLAKY OATMEAL:
Stir in oats. Cook 1 minute for quick oats, stirring occasionally. Cook 5 minutes or longer for old fashioned oats. Cover pan, remove from heat and let stand a few minutes.

FOR CREAMY OATMEAL:
Stir in oats. Bring to a boil and cook as above.

FOR CHOCOLATE OATMEAL:
Use 2 cups chocolate dairy drink in place of milk in above recipe. Cook as directed.

Servings: 6
Source: The Quaker Oats Company
